Just after some advice on how to use this.

Have put in one dose of the treatment as described in the instructions, but the booklet is a bit rubbish and neglects to mention how long it would take to kill the snails, how many doses should be used, and how often it should be added to the water.

Can anyone help with this?

Please note it's the Copper Sulphate solution stuff that actually kills snails, and can be toxic to fish if overdosed. Also, does it kill snail eggs?

You would really be better off getting some kind of loach to eat the snails, just hate adding chemicals to a tank if another way can be found, you could end up creating more trouble than worth, unless of course the snails are getting out of hand and breeding like no tomorrow which can also be toxic for the fish hmmm :unsure:
 
Not sure about it killing the eggs, however it'll most likely kill them when they hatch.

What fish do you have in the tank? Copper can be harmful to some.. especially the scaleless fish and shrimps.

Also, keep an eye on the ammonia levels... all those snails dying and decaying could be nasty if you dont clean them out
